By COLlive reporter
Over 120 ladies attended the annual cooking demo, featuring celebrated cookbook authors, at Chabad of Dollard in Montreal directed by Rabbi Leibel and Chana Fine.
On Monday night, they hosted Norene Gilletz, a household name in Canadian Jewish homes; and the author of Second Helpings Please, The Food Processor Bible, Healthy Helpings and Norene’s Healthy Kitchen.
Keeping with the theme, “Fast, Fabulous and Healthy”, Norene presented easy recipes and techniques for quicker food prep and healthier eating. The evening began with hot cups of carrot and sweet potato soup followed by a sensational red eggplant dip.
Following the demo, the women were treated to a full dinner buffet, with Maple Glazed Salmon, Cranberry Quinoa Salad, Asian Coleslaw, and of course, the desserts: chocolate rugelach and apple crostata made with Norene’s easy and versatile Flaky Ginger Ale Pastry.
It was a special moment for Norene and lots of her Facebook fans, as they got to meet face to face for the very first time. Norene’s cookbooks were sold at the event, and were signed with personal messages by Norene herself.
Several women brought their old cookbooks, some of them dating as far back as the 1960’s, for Norene to sign.
